Eigenvalue placement and simultaneous stabilization using tabu search

Abstract

This paper considers the problem of designing controllers to place simultaneously the closedloop eigenvalues of a finite number of plants, representing different operating conditions of a system, in a specific region in the left half of the complex s plane. The problem of selecting the controller gains is converted to a simple optimization problem with an eigenvalue-based performance criterion, which is solved by a tabu search. Various performance criteria are suggested and formulated, allowing the eigenvalue placement in distinctive locations in the complex s plane. Several examples are included to demonstrate the usefulness of the method.
